Qualitative Factors in an RFQ (Request for Quote) for crypto services or technology refer to non-quantifiable criteria used to evaluate vendor proposals beyond mere price considerations. These elements assess aspects like vendor reputation, technical expertise in blockchain infrastructure, solution scalability, security protocols, and client support capabilities. Their purpose is to ensure that the selected solution or partner aligns with the institutional client’s long-term strategic objectives, risk appetite, and operational requirements, extending beyond immediate cost.
Mechanism
The evaluation mechanism for Qualitative Factors typically involves a scoring matrix or rubric where subject matter experts assess each proposal against predefined criteria. This process often includes detailed reviews of technical architectures, demonstrations of proposed crypto trading platforms, and interviews with key personnel. For instance, a vendor’s experience with specific Layer 2 solutions or their approach to multi-party computation for secure transactions would be weighted and scored, providing a nuanced assessment of their capabilities.
Methodology
The methodology for incorporating Qualitative Factors emphasizes a balanced evaluation approach, preventing an exclusive focus on the lowest bid. Principles include clear communication of all assessment criteria within the RFQ document, consistent application of the scoring system by a diverse evaluation committee, and thorough documentation of the rationale behind each score. This systematic integration ensures that strategic considerations, such as long-term partnership viability and technological innovation, receive appropriate weight in selecting a crypto service provider.
